Junior National Team Trials

Junior Trials were held over the weekend in Squamish BC on the Mamquam river. Athletes from accross Canada came to earn their spot on the Junior National Team. Alberta had six athletes competing, from the 2x veteran Marissa Dederer to 12 year old Hannah Penner. None disapointed.

Marissa claimed a solid second place for the weekend by making percentage every day and being consistent, for her third year on the Junior Team. AJ Cole of Crowsnest Pass made the junior team for his first time with a great run out of the gate, on day 1. From there on he kept cool under pressure and held his spot.

Hayden Daniels in C1 finished just off the team but has shown great improvement from last year. Levi Severtson and Ryley Penner traded days with some great idividual runs that were 4th and 5th respectively. Hannah Penner improved all weekend and was making some great moves on the final day. All four of these youngsters have a bright future with a combined 15 years of being juniors still ahead of them.

Marissa and AJ will represent Canada at the Junior Worlds in France in July. Hayden and Levi will also be representing Canada at the Youth Olympic Games in Singapore in August.
